Introduction to Maya
Maya is a powerful 3D computer animation, modeling, simulation, and rendering tool used in the film, television, and video game industries. It has been a dominant force in the field of computer-generated imagery (CGI) for over two decades. Maya’s versatility and extensive feature set make it an ideal choice for artists, designers, and technicians alike. In this article, we will explore five ways Maya can be utilized to create stunning visual effects and animations.1. Modeling and Texturing
Maya offers a wide range of tools for creating complex 3D models and textures. Its modeling toolkit includes features such as NURBS, polygons, and subdivision surfaces, allowing artists to create detailed and realistic models. Additionally, Maya’s texturing capabilities enable the creation of complex materials and shaders, which can be used to simulate real-world surfaces and environments. Some key features of Maya’s modeling and texturing tools include: * Dynamic simulation: allows for the creation of realistic simulations of natural phenomena, such as water, fire, and smoke * Advanced rendering: enables the creation of high-quality images and animations with advanced lighting and shading effects * UV mapping: allows for the precise control of texture placement and scaling on 3D models2. Animation and Rigging
Maya’s animation and rigging tools enable artists to create complex character animations and movements. Its keyframe animation system allows for precise control over object movements and transformations, while its rigging system enables the creation of complex character skeletons and skinning systems. Some key features of Maya’s animation and rigging tools include: * Keyframe animation: allows for the creation of complex animations using keyframe techniques * Character rigging: enables the creation of complex character skeletons and skinning systems * Dynamics and simulation: allows for the creation of realistic simulations of natural phenomena, such as hair, cloth, and water3. Visual Effects and Compositing
Maya’s visual effects and compositing tools enable artists to create stunning visual effects and composite images. Its particle system allows for the creation of complex simulations of natural phenomena, such as fire, smoke, and water, while its compositing system enables the combination of multiple images and animations into a single cohesive image. Some key features of Maya’s visual effects and compositing tools include: * Particle system: allows for the creation of complex simulations of natural phenomena * Compositing: enables the combination of multiple images and animations into a single cohesive image * Advanced rendering: enables the creation of high-quality images and animations with advanced lighting and shading effects4. Lighting and Rendering
Maya’s lighting and rendering tools enable artists to create stunning images and animations with advanced lighting and shading effects. Its lighting system allows for the creation of complex lighting setups, including area lights, spot lights, and volume lights, while its rendering system enables the creation of high-quality images and animations with advanced features such as global illumination and caustics. Some key features of Maya’s lighting and rendering tools include: * Advanced lighting: enables the creation of complex lighting setups with advanced features such as global illumination and caustics * Rendering: enables the creation of high-quality images and animations with advanced features such as motion blur and depth of field * Image-based lighting: allows for the creation of realistic lighting effects using image-based lighting techniques5. Scripting and Automation
Maya’s scripting and automation tools enable artists to automate repetitive tasks and create custom tools and scripts. Its scripting language, MEL, allows for the creation of complex scripts and tools, while its Python interface enables the integration of Maya with other applications and scripts. Some key features of Maya’s scripting and automation tools include: * MEL scripting: allows for the creation of complex scripts and tools using Maya’s scripting language * Python interface: enables the integration of Maya with other applications and scripts using Python * Automation: enables the automation of repetitive tasks and workflows using Maya’s scripting and automation tools💡 Note: Maya's extensive feature set and versatility make it an ideal choice for artists, designers, and technicians alike. However, its complexity and steep learning curve can make it challenging for beginners to learn and master.
In summary, Maya is a powerful tool for creating stunning visual effects and animations. Its extensive feature set and versatility make it an ideal choice for artists, designers, and technicians alike. Whether you’re working in the film, television, or video game industry, Maya has the tools and features you need to bring your creative vision to life.
What is Maya used for?
+Maya is a 3D computer animation, modeling, simulation, and rendering tool used in the film, television, and video game industries.
What are some of the key features of Maya?
+Some key features of Maya include its modeling and texturing tools, animation and rigging tools, visual effects and compositing tools, lighting and rendering tools, and scripting and automation tools.
Is Maya difficult to learn?
+Yes, Maya can be challenging to learn, especially for beginners. However, with practice and patience, it is possible to master the software and unlock its full potential.